Overview of Dr. Volodarskiy
Dr. Alexander Volodarskiy is a cardiologist in Forest Hills, NY. He received his medical degree from State University of New York Downstate Medical Center College of Medicine and has been in practice 7 years. He also speaks multiple languages, including Russian. He specializes in echocardiography, nuclear cardiology, and cardiac CT.
